School Conferences Sample Clauses

School Conferences. An employee must be granted up to sixteen (16) hours unpaid time per year for school conferences. If an employee has vacation or compensatory time off available for use, the employee may choose to use that leave for this purpose.

School Conferences. 14.1 Employees may attend school conferences pursuant to Minn. Stat. §181.9412, as amended.
School Conferences. School conferences will be scheduled during the first two trimesters, with teachers participating in conference or conference-related activities, i.e. calling parents of students who are not doing well. The evening and day sessions shall be decided at the individual building level. In exchange for the nine hours of conference time, teachers will be released from nine school-day hours. The school calendar shall reflect this exchange.

School Conferences. School conferences held in September and June shall be held on school time.
School Conferences. School conferences will be scheduled during each of the three trimesters. During the first and second trimesters teachers will participate in twelve (12) hours in grades K-6 and nine (9) hours in grades 7-12 of conference or conference-related activities, i.e. calling parents of students who are not doing well. The evening and day sessions shall be decided at the individual building level. Conferences in the third trimester will be three (3) hours and scheduled by the individual buildings.
